Proposal
Section 73 application to vary conditions 13 and 14 attached to planning permission 22/P/1963/FUL (Alteration of building layout and erection of a 3 storey side extension to extend existing 7no. flats ; erection of a 3 storey rear extension to form an additional 3no. dwellings (creating a total of 10no. units on site), together with demolition of garage , creation of new access, parking and all associated works). To allow condition 13 to state that no above ground works, or any demolition, should take place, until the condition has been discharged, and condition 14 to state that no above ground works, or any demolition, should take place, until the condition has been discharged.

About amendment applications
An amendment application makes limited changes to a permission that already exists; anything beyond modest adjustment needs a fresh application. More in our guide to planning application types.
